Sanctuary Supported Living is delighted to be recruiting for a Female Domestic Assistant at our CQC Retirement Communities Service at Rosary Priory, Bushey.

At Rosary Priory, we provide personal care and support for retired nuns from the Dominican Sisters of Saint Catherine of Siena Newcastle Natal, ensuring they have comfort, independence and peace of mind during their retirement.

The position of Cleaner is referred to internally at Sanctuary, as Domestic Assistant.

The role of Cleaner will include:

Providing a personalised domestic service to the sisters, fulfilling housekeeping, cleaning and domestic tasks to meet sisters’ needs

Ensuring a clean, comfortable and safe environment is maintained in the communal and service areas

Responsible for the daily use of housekeeping equipment

Monitoring of stock levels and reordering of supplies

Skills and experiences:

Experience is not essential however some experience of undertaking general housekeeping or domestic duties would be desirable

An approachable, caring and compassionate attitude is essential

Enthusiastic and flexible with a strong “can-do” attitude

Ability to demonstrate a competent level of numeracy and literacy

NVQ2 in Hospitality and Catering or willing to work towards, is desirable

Due to the sensitive needs of our clients, we can only consider female applicants. Gender is considered to be a genuine occupational requirement in accordance with paragraph 1 of schedule 9 of the Equality Act 2010.
